Post-Workout Recovery is a massage essential oil blend in the pain collection, combining Marjoram, Peppermint and Ginger. It uses 10 drops at 3% dilution in Sweet Almond Oil. Massage gently into the skin over the desired area.

Recipe

Format: Massage · Dilution: 3% · Total drops: 10 · Carrier: Sweet Almond Oil · Duration: 2 weeks

OilDropsRole
Marjoram4primary
Peppermint3supporting
Ginger3supporting

How to make & use

  1. 1. Measure your oils

    Combine Marjoram (4 drops), Peppermint (3 drops), Ginger (3 drops).

  2. 2. Dilute

    Add the oils to Sweet Almond Oil, aiming for about 3% dilution (10 drops total).

  3. 3. Use

    Massage gently into the skin over the desired area.

Safety

AdultsGenerally suitable when properly diluted
ChildrenNot recommended
PregnancyNot recommended
ElderlyGenerally suitable when properly diluted
